Key Responsibilities:
Responsibility for the recruitment of new technicians for upcoming projects and short-term sales requests
Developing a pipeline of Wind Turbine Technicians to meet project requirements and peak period demands
Being a key driver in GWS’s recruitment and branding strategy, ensuring market presence and ongoing development of our candidate database of skilled technicians for future works and within new markets
Negotiating pay rates and finalizing arrangements between internal stakeholders and candidates
Maintaining a globally aligned recruitment process and approach, focusing on fast initiation and delivery, flexibility and scalability
Continuous development and improvements of both process and tools around our recruitment process, to improve efficiency, global alignment and candidate experience
Reviewing internal recruitment policies to ensure effectiveness of selection techniques and recruitment programs
Ensure effective activities in relevant markets based on business needs and the global recruitment strategy
Providing improved customer experience within GWS for internal stakeholders driving the recruitment process; through focus, communication and proactivity by;
Collaborating with the internal HR Team to ensure clear overviews, progress, and communication internally within HR, and towards the business
Ensuring aligned expectations and prioritisation of recruitment needs with key stakeholders, primarily our Sales and Operations Teams
Working collaboratively with GWS Resource Managers to ensure alignment of internal capacity vs. the need to recruit new technicians
Foster productive relationships with internal and external stakeholders
Understand and follow federal, state, and local laws around hiring
